Potential Dangers



Before starting a medical weight reduction program, it's prudent to be familiar with the possible threats involved. While medical weight-loss programs can be reliable, there are specific threats to take into consideration.

One feasible risk is the advancement of dietary deficiencies because of a restricted diet or decreased food intake. This can bring about wellness concerns otherwise thoroughly checked by healthcare specialists. In addition, some weight reduction medicines or procedures may have adverse effects such as queasiness, looseness of the bowels, or insomnia. It is essential to discuss these potential side effects with your physician prior to beginning any kind of weight management program.



One more threat to be knowledgeable about is the possibility of reclaiming the weight after completing the program. Without correct lifestyle modifications and ongoing assistance, it can be testing to preserve weight management in the long term. Moreover, quick weight-loss can sometimes lead to muscular tissue loss, which can adversely influence your metabolic process.

It's essential to comprehend these risks and job very closely with your healthcare provider to decrease them while making the most of the advantages of your weight management journey.
